/**二级页面通栏**/
.mgbr_bj{
  /*background: url("../images/bg_hotel.png")center  no-repeat;*/
}

.vhc1{
  width: 1200px;
  margin: auto;
  margin-top: 80px;
}
.vhc1_1,.vhc1_2{
  width: 580px;
}

.vhc1_1top{
  width: 240px;
  height: 180px;
}
.vhc1_1bott{
  width: 238px;
  height: 108px;
  border-left: 1px solid #e5e5e5;
  border-right: 1px solid #e5e5e5;
  border-bottom: 1px solid #e5e5e5;
}
.vhc1_1top img{
  width: 100%;
  height: 100%;
}
.vhc1_1bott img{
  width: 160px;
  height: 60px;
  margin: 24px 40px;
}
.vhc1_fr{
  float: left;
  margin-left: 30px;
}
.vhc1_ftop{
  width: 264px;
  font-size: 24px;
  color: #333333;
  font-weight: 600;
  line-height: 36px;
}
.vhc1_fbott{
  font-size: 14px;
  color: #666666;
  width: 300px;
  margin-top: 18px;
  line-height: 26px;
}
.vhc2{
  width: 1200px;
  margin: auto;
  margin-top: 40px;
}
.vhc2_1{
  font-size: 20px;
  color: #666666;
}
.vhc2_img{
  margin-top: 20px;
  width: 1200px;
}
.vhc2_img_1{
  margin-bottom: 9px;
  float: left;
  width: 394px;
  height: 110px;
  background: #f7f7f7;
}
.vhc2_img_1lft{
  margin-right: 9px;
}
.vhc2_c_div{
  height: 48px;
  margin-top: 31px;
  margin-left: 66px;
}
.vhc2_c1 img{
  width: 48px;
  height: 48px;
  margin-right: 24px;
}
.vhc2_c2{
}
.vhc2_c2_1{
  color: #333333;
  font-weight: 600;
  font-size: 20px;
  line-height:20px;
}
.vhc2_c2_2{
  font-size:14px;
  color: #666666;
  height: 14px;
  margin-top: 14px;
}
.mgc6_v_htlbj{
  background: #F5F5F6;
  margin-top: 20px;
}
.vhc3{
  width: 1200px;
  height: 760px;
  margin: auto;
  text-align: center;
}
.vhc3_img{
  position: absolute;
  width: 1200px;
  height: 530px;
  margin-top: 60px;
  background: url("https://mgresource.h-world.com/website/v_hotel_img.png") no-repeat 0 0;
  background-position:center center;
}
.mgc7imgdiv{
  height: 100px;
}
.vhc3_d_s1_hr{
  height: 84px;
  border-bottom: 1px solid #008bae;
}
.vhc3_hr_w{
  width: 42%;
}
.vhc3_hr_w2{
  width: 40%;
}
.vhc3_d_s1{
  width: 300px;
  position: absolute;
  left: 0px;
  height: 110px;
  z-index: 100;
  background: #ffffff;
}
.vhc3_d_s1top1{
  top: 30px;
}
.vhc3_d_s1top2{
  top: 12px;
}
.vhc3_d_s1top3{
  top: 30px;
}
.vhc3_d_s1top4{
  top: 12px;
}
.vhc3_d_s1top5{
  top: 17px;
}
.vhc3_d_s1top6{
  top: 30px;
}

/*.vhc3_hrl{*/
  /*width: 32px;*/
  /*height: 106px;*/
  /*border-left: 2px solid #008bae;*/
  /*border-top: 2px solid #008bae;*/
  /*border-bottom: 2px solid #008bae;*/
  /*float: left;*/
/*}*/
/*.vhc3_hrr{*/
  /*float: right;*/
  /*width: 32px;*/
  /*height: 106px;*/
  /*border-right: 2px solid #008bae;*/
  /*border-top: 2px solid #008bae;*/
  /*border-bottom: 2px solid #008bae;*/
/*}*/
.vhc3_hrc{
  /*padding: 16px 20px;*/
  border: 1px solid #ffffff;
  font-size:14px;
  font-weight:400;
  color:rgba(51,51,51,1);
  /*height: calc(110px - 32px);*/
  line-height:22px;
  background: url("https://mgresource.h-world.com/website/v_hbk3.png");
  background-size: 100% 100%;
}
.vhc3_hrc div{
  width: 250px;
  margin: 20px 25px;
  text-align: left;
}
.vhc3_hrcdiv{
  height: 66px;
}
.vhc3_con_bor{
  width: 502px;
  height: 530px;
  position: absolute;
  top: 0px;
  left: 50%;
  margin-left: -251px;
}
/*第一个*/
.vhc3_cb1{
  position: absolute;
  /*border: 1px solid red;*/
  width: 96px;
  height: 167px;
  left: 50%;
  margin-left: -50px;
  z-index: 1002;
}
.vhc3_cb2{
  position: absolute;
  /*border: 1px solid red;*/
  width: 96px;
  height: 167px;
  margin-left: 45px;
  margin-top: 92px;
}

.vhc3_cb3{
  position: absolute;
  /*border: 1px solid red;*/
  width: 96px;
  height: 167px;
  margin-top: 90px;
  right: 48px;
}
.vhc3_cb4{
  position: absolute;
  /*border: 1px solid red;*/
  width: 96px;
  height: 167px;
  margin-top: 270px;
  margin-left: 45px;
}
.vhc3_cb5{
  position: absolute;
  /*border: 1px solid red;*/
  width: 96px;
  height: 167px;
  margin-top: 270px;
  right: 48px;
}
.vhc3_cb6{
  position: absolute;
  /*border: 1px solid red;*/
  width: 96px;
  height: 167px;
  left: 50%;
  bottom: 0px;
  margin-left: -50px;
}
.vhc3_cb1_b,.vhc3_cb2_b,.vhc3_cb3_b,.vhc3_cb4_b,.vhc3_cb5_b,.vhc3_cb6_b{
  -moz-transform:rotate(-60deg);
  -webkit-transform:rotate(-60deg);
  -o-transform:rotate(-60deg);
  -ms-transform:rotate(-60deg);
  transform:rotate(-60deg);
  /*border: 1px solid darkviolet;*/
}
.vhc3_cb1_c,.vhc3_cb2_c,.vhc3_cb3_c,.vhc3_cb4_c,.vhc3_cb5_c,.vhc3_cb6_c{
  -moz-transform:rotate(60deg);
  -webkit-transform:rotate(60deg);
  -o-transform:rotate(60deg);
  -ms-transform:rotate(60deg);
  transform:rotate(60deg);
  /*border: 1px solid chartreuse;*/
}
/*弹框部分*/
.vhctk2{
  width: 73%;
  position: absolute;
  top: 93px;
}
.vhctk3{
  width: 29.2%;
  position: absolute;
  bottom: 148px;
  height: 110px;
}
.vhctk4{
  width: 29.1%;
  position: absolute;
  right: 0px;
  height: 110px;
  top: 91px;
}
.vhctk5{
  width: 29.1%;
  position: absolute;
  right: 0px;
  height: 110px;
  top: 272px;
}
.vhctk6{
  width: 42%;
  position: absolute;
  right: 0px;
  height: 110px;
  bottom: 59px;
}
.vhc3_hr_w4{
  width: 42%;
}
.vhc3_d_s1_r{
  width: 300px;
  position: absolute;
  right: 0px;
  height: 110px;
  z-index: 100;
  background: #ffffff;
}
























